Capitalism Hates Moms
This week, Senator Joe Manchin insisted any extension of the Child Tax Credit payments should include a work requirement.
"Before you start saying, ‘is it going to be permanent?’, let's see how we're doing this. Let's make sure that we're getting it to the right people.“
And who would that be, Joe?
"There's no work requirements whatsoever. There's no education requirements whatsoever for better skill sets – Don't you think if we want to help the children, the people should make some effort?"
Strong words from a fellow whose entire industry takes August off work like classical Versailles. But I guess budgeting has never been politicians’ strong suit.

What is Woman?
After centuries of having this question answered for us, we have struggled to rise to the opportunity of defining ourselves. It’s become an individual project, each woman left to figure it out alone because the thing we all have in common is portrayed as our greatest weakness.
The primordial origins of what it is to be female have been weaponized against us so effectively that we are terrified of them. To even suggest that the potential to gestate offspring is fundamental to femaleness is controversial, and feminism has traditionally been about exploring all the other things women can do.
